Chandanpur Population - Cuttack, Orissa

Chandanpur is a medium size village located in Tangi Block of Cuttack district, Orissa with total 121 families residing. The Chandanpur village has population of 647 of which 333 are males while 314 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Chandanpur village population of children with age 0-6 is 108 which makes up 16.69 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Chandanpur village is 943 which is lower than Orissa state average of 979. Child Sex Ratio for the Chandanpur as per census is 929, lower than Orissa average of 941.

Chandanpur village has lower literacy rate compared to Orissa. In 2011, literacy rate of Chandanpur village was 28.39 % compared to 72.87 % of Orissa. In Chandanpur Male literacy stands at 35.38 % while female literacy rate was 20.99 %.

Caste Factor

In Chandanpur village, most of the village population is from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 93.51 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 3.25 % of total population in Chandanpur village.

Work Profile

In Chandanpur village out of total population, 226 were engaged in work activities. 69.03 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 30.97 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 226 workers engaged in Main Work, 3 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 140 were Agricultural labourer.
